Question 314417: Jack mows the lawn in 3 hours. Jane mows the same yard in 4 hours. If they worked together how much time would it take them to mow the yard?

Let x = time it takes them to mow the yard working together. This means that in 1 hour, Jack can mow 1/3 of the yard, Jane can mow 1/4 of the yard, and working together, they can do 1/x of the yard.

The equation is


The LCD is 12x, so multiply both sides of the equation by 12x



hours (a little less than 2 hours working together.
